RN Non Invasive Cardiac Testing
Brown University Health is seeking a Registered Nurse for Non-Invasive Cardiac Testing who will evaluate patients referred for cardiac stress testing. The role involves performing cardiovascular assessments, administering stress tests, and managing patient care during procedures.

Responsibilities
Reviews the patient’s medical record, including history, medications, and relevant labs
Performs focused cardiovascular assessments prior to non-invasive testing
Identifies potential risks or contraindications and communicates findings
Provides patient and family education regarding procedures
Ensures required consents and documentation are completed
Provides nursing care before, during, and after non-invasive cardiology procedures
Supports exercise (ETT), stress echoes, and pharmacologic stress testing
Assists technologists with patient preparation and workflow coordination
Ensures emergency equipment is available in the testing area
Evaluates patients for stress testing per guidelines
Explains protocols and obtains patient consent
Performs and interprets 12-lead EKGs
Identifies ischemia, infarction, and other abnormalities
Recognizes arrhythmias and initiates interventions per ACLS
Monitors patients during recovery and documents findings
Initiates and manages IV access
Administers medications according to non-invasive cardiology protocols
Administers Definity/contrast agents or agitated saline per protocol
Evaluates patient responses and reports abnormalities
Communicates effectively with providers, technologists, and other departments
Coordinates patient flow to support an efficient outpatient schedule
Maintains accurate and timely documentation of assessments, procedures, and medications
Practices ALARA principles when supporting imaging areas where radiation is present
Uses and exchanges personal dosimeters when required
Performs other duties as assigned
Qualification
Required
Graduate of an accredited school of nursing
Licensed RN in the State of Massachusetts
Current BLS and ACLS certification
Demonstrated knowledge of age-specific care
Preferred
Minimum two years of clinical nursing experience preferred in cardiology, emergency, critical care, or outpatient diagnostic imaging
